Abstract
Electric starter for internal combustión engine including a launch mechanism consisting of a pinion that moves by rotation and translation relative to the starter shaft and joined by means of a free wheel to a hollow shaft or sleeve that is screwed or it slides in helical grooves, characterized in that it includes in combination positive fixing means (8, 9) in the rest position, during operation of the motor, of the launching mechanism (2) relative to the starter housing and a device friction (19, 20) which, acting on the sleeve (7) of the launch mechanism, brakes it in rotation during its return to the rest position after starting the engine.
